A friend logs off as I'm typing an IM. Just before I send it, I get the message that <avatar> is offline. That's normal. But I don't notice it and press Return to send the IM, whereupon I get the instant message that the friend is online. I check my Friends list and the avatar is showing as online. It happens so quickly that it isn't possible for anyone to log out and in in the second or two that it takes. Then, if I send another IM, I get the message that the avatar is offline and that the message will be stored, as normal. It happens quite a lot, and with any Friend. Whirly Fizzle Posted April 8, 2017 Share Posted April 8, 2017 1 hour ago, Phil Deakins said: ETA: I've found it - BUG-48140. Does it stay as BUG until it's been acknowledged? That issue won't move. If LL accept the bug they will clone it over into one of their internal projects. SVC-6653 was already accepted & imported as ER-486 (look in the issue history to see the imported issue), but we have no way to see if ER-486 is still open or not. If ER-486 is still open they will likely close your new BUG as a duplicate.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
